Budapest, Hungary
Adam was exposed to different cultures from the very beginning. He started composing and programming on different music editing software at the age of 12-13. After experimenting on computers for several years, he got involved in DJ-ing with his friends at around 16. His fascination with the beat led him to explore and get acquainted with ethnic instruments (Arabic and African drums, latin percussion).
At the age of 18, he met the unique Hungarian psychedelic rock bands, Tanu Tuva and Korai Öröm, whose rehearsal room served as a creative gathering place for the musicians' collective to experiment with analogue synthesizers, percussion and flutes.
